The province consists of Cebu Island, as well as 167 smaller islands, which include [[Mactan]], [[Bantayan Island|Bantayan]], [[Malapascua Island|Malapascua]], [[Olango Island Group|Olango]] and the [[Camotes Islands]]. But the highly urbanized cities of [[Cebu City|Cebu]], Lapu-Lapu and [[Mandaue]] are [[Independent component city|independent cities]] not under provincial supervision, yet are often grouped with the province for geographical and statistical purposes. The province's land area is {{convert|4944|km2|sp=us}}, or when the three independent cities (Cebu City, Lapu-Lapu and Mandaue) are included for geographical purposes, the total area is {{convert|5342|km2|sp=us}}. Cebu's central location, proximity to an unusually exotic tourist destination, ready access to a diversity of plant, animal and geological wonders within the island, and remoteness from earthquake and typhoon activity are some of the special attributes of Cebu. ===Cebu Island=== Cebu Island is the [[List of islands by area#Islands|126th largest island in the world]]. Cebu Island itself is long and narrow, stretching {{convert|196|km|sp=us}} from north to south and {{convert|32|km|sp=us}} across at its widest point.{{sfn|Encyclopædia Britannica|2016}} It has narrow coastlines, limestone plateaus, and coastal plains. It also has rolling hills and rugged mountain ranges traversing the northern and southern lengths of the island. Cebu's highest mountains are over {{convert|1000|m}} high. Flat tracts of land can be found in the city of [[Bogo, Cebu|Bogo]] and in the towns of [[San Remigio, Cebu|San Remigio]], [[Medellin, Cebu|Medellin]] and [[Daanbantayan, Cebu|Daanbantayan]] at the northern region of the province.{{sfn|Encyclopædia Britannica|2016}} The island's area is {{Convert|4468|km2}},{{sfn|Dahl|1998}} making it the 9th largest island in the Philippines. It supports over 5.2 million people,<ref name="Britannica">{{cite web |title=Cebu |url=https://www.britannica.com/place/Cebu |website=[[Britannica]] |access-date=10 February 2024}}</ref> of which an estimated 2.9 million live in [[Metro Cebu]].<ref name="USTDA">{{cite web |title=Philippines: Metro Cebu Intelligent Transportation System Master Plan Technical Assistance |url=https://www.ustda.gov/business_opp_oversea/philippines-metro-cebu-intelligent-transportation-system-master-plan-technical-assistance-2/ |publisher=US Trade and Development Agency |access-date=10 February 2024}}</ref> Beaches, coral atolls, islands, and rich fishing grounds surround Cebu. Coal was first discovered in Cebu about 1837. There were 15 localities over the whole island, on both coasts; some desultory mining had been carried out Naga near Mount Uling, but most serious operations were at Licos and Camansi west of Compostela and Danao.{{sfn|Abella y Casariego|1886}} Active work ceased about 1895 with insurrections, and no production worked for more than ten years. A topographic and geologic survey of Compostela, Danao, and Carmen took place in 1906.{{sfn|Smith|1907}} The Compostela-Danao coalfield contained about six million workable tons. There are 2 seasons in Cebu − the dry and wet season.<ref>{{cite web |url=http://kidlat.pagasa.dost.gov.ph/cab/statfram.htm |title=Weather |access-date=April 26, 2017 |url-status=dead |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20130525212029/http://kidlat.pagasa.dost.gov.ph/cab/statfram.htm |archive-date=May 25, 2013 }}</ref> It is dry and sunny most of the year with some occasional rains during the months of June to December. The province of Cebu normally gets typhoons once a year or none. Northern Cebu gets more rainfall and typhoons than southern Cebu because it has a different climate. [[Typhoon Haiyan]] (Yolanda) hit Northern Cebu in 2013 killing 73 people and injuring 348 others. Though most typhoons hit only the northern part of Cebu, the urban areas in central Cebu are sometimes hit, such as when [[Typhoon Mike]] (Ruping), one of the worst to hit Cebu lashed the central Cebu area in 1990. 31 years later, [[Typhoon Rai]] struck the central and southern portions of the province. Cebu's temperatures can reach a high of {{convert|36|C|F}} from March to May, and as low as {{convert|18|C|F}} in the mountains during the wet season. The average temperature is around {{convert|24|to|34|C|F}}, and does not fluctuate much except during the month of May, which is the hottest month. It is currently endangered. It has been observed as far in urban areas as Cebu City, but is mainly abundant in the species' last stronghold, the Nug-as rainforest of [[Alcoy, Cebu|Alcoy]]. It can also be found in Casili, [[Consolacion]] and the mountainous areas of the [[N815 highway|Trans Central Highway]]. The bird was once featured on the official stamp of Cebu of 1992.]] [[Endemic]] species in Cebu include the Cebu Flowerpecker (''[[Dicaeum quadricolor]]''), Cebu Slender Skink (''[[Brachymeles cebuensis]]''), Uling Goby (''[[Sicyopus cebuensis]]''), and Black Shama (''[[Copsychus cebuensis]]''). There is also a subspecies of [[Idea leuconoe]] that is only endemic to Cebu. ''I. l. jumaloni'' is endemic to the area of [[Kawasan Falls]] in [[Badian, Cebu|Badian]], hence its common name, the ''Kawasan Paper Kite Butterfly''. The subspecies is also named after Julian Jumalon, a Cebuano [[Lepidopterist]] and butterfly artist.
